Friends of Irise

foiWho are they?
Friends of Irise (FOI) are a student group dedicated to raising awareness of global gender inequality. They support the organisation Irise International which seeks to address a major cause of girls in East Africa missing school; periods. Friends of Irise originated in Sheffield and has expanded to open branches in Birmingham, Cardiff and Manchester.

What do they do?
Friends of Irise aim to raise awareness of gender inequality throughout the world. They run teaching programmes in UK schools and fundraise to support the efforts of Irise International. Throughout the academic year they also host University events to educate and advocate.
